Oil Pan: Installation

Remove old sealant from oil pan bolts and bolt holes in lower cylinder block. Apply silicone sealant to sealing surface of engine block. Position oil pan, install bolts/studs in original position. Install oil pan-to-transaxle housing bolts and tighten to specification. Tighten oil pan bolts and nuts in reverse sequence of removal. See Figure. Tighten bolts/studs to specification. See T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S . To complete installation, reverse removal procedure. Fill crankcase with oil. Start engine and check for leaks.
